The Customer Care Supervisor manages the daily order entry and customer service operations for UPS Supply Chain Solutions across multiple clients and sectors (healthcare, high-tech, retail). He/She serves as the primary liaison between clients, customers (i.e., clients’ customers), customer service staff, and internal functional groups.
This position manages high volume and high touch customer contact through heavy phone interaction and regular face-to-face meetings (e.g., customer visits, quarterly business reviews, etc.). The Customer Care Supervisor keeps clients updated with service, product, customer, and system issues. He/She is responsible for participating in client solution development and ongoing maintenance of clients’ profits and losses.
This position works with the Information Technology (IT) group to resolve system issues and service failures and to implement system enhancements. The Customer Care Supervisor ensures successful Electronic Data Interchange (EDI) implementation. He/She assists with functional administrative activities and reconciles Agency Reimbursement Amount (ARA) based account reviews.
This position manages the customer service training program and ensures compliance (i.e., contractual, regulatory, and corporate). He/She leads the development and writing of standard operating procedures (SOPs), work instructions, processes, and SOWs. This position generates reports (e.g., performance, phone call statistics, profitability, service, etc.) and measures and analyzes performance results.
The Customer Care Supervisor supervises others within the department.
